The Hague Commission on private international law is an intergovernmental international organization. Its purpose is to solve the legal conflicts among countries through the formulation of conventions, so as to achieve the purpose of gradually unifying private international law.

Hague certification, apostille in English. The Hague certification is based on the Hague Agreement. As the name suggests, as long as the document is certified by the Hague, it will be recognized by the countries that signed the Hague Agreement.

▶How to handle Swedish consular certification

If Swedish documents are used in China, usually the Chinese examination and approval authority will require Swedish consular certification before they can be accepted.

The Chinese Embassy and consulate in Sweden handle consular certification, which refers to the confirmation of Swedish notarization, the seal and signature of Swedish government departments on the documents applying for consular certification.

1. The document is true and legal, and there is no content that obviously violates Chinese laws or may damage China’s national and social public interests;

2. if the document for certification is more than two pages, it shall be bound into a volume and sealed with fire paint, cross seal or steel seal to ensure the integrity of the document.
